Cricket is a bat-and-ball game played between two teams of eleven players each on a field at the center of which is a 22-yard (20-metre) pitch with a wicket at each end, each comprising two bails balanced on three stumps.
First played: 16th century; South-East England
Olympic: (1900 Summer Olympics only)
Team members: 11 players per side (substitutes permitted in some circumstances)
